Re: Refractory RLS
I just had 500 mg Feraheme earlier this week. Medicare paid for it. It also paid for two infusions of the same iron form a week apart three years ago when my iron levels were even lower. Be aware that this is just plain Medicare. If you have a Medicare Advantage plan, the rules are set by your plan ...

Re: Recent restrictions on length of opioid prescriptions
I regularly use CVS to fill my 28 day supply of methadone, without any problems. (28 days has become the new standard in at least two major medical systems in the Boston, MA area). My reading of the CVS announcement was that the 7 day limit would apply to initial prescriptions, say after surgery or ...
